The short version

Santa Clara has notably lower household income than the US average, with a median household income of $32,794. Population has fallen 16% since 2000, a loss of 307 residents. 14%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her, below the national rate of 33%. Median home value is $84,500. With a median age of 49.4, the population is older than the US median of 38.8. Households here earn about 36% less than the New Mexico median.

Frequently asked

How many people live in Santa Clara, New Mexico?

Santa Clara, New Mexico has about 1,637 residents according to the 2020 American Community Survey.

What is the median household income in Santa Clara, New Mexico?

The typical household in Santa Clara, New Mexico earns about $32,794 a year. Half of households make more than that, and half make less.

Is Santa Clara, New Mexico expensive?

In Santa Clara, New Mexico, the median home is worth about $84,500, and the typical rent is about $647 a month.

How educated are people in Santa Clara, New Mexico?

About 13.7% of adults age 25 and over in Santa Clara, New Mexico hold a bachelor's degree or higher.

What is the poverty rate in Santa Clara, New Mexico?

About 32.4% of people in Santa Clara, New Mexico live below the federal poverty line.
